I bought a beautiful (and cheap) floor-length skirt (like this one) from a store called Gordman's. It's made out of superthin cotton, however, and although the top five 'tiers' are hemmed/ sewn together so the skirt doesn't fall apart, the very bottom floor-sweeping part isn't. It's already starting to unravel from the bottom up. Is there anything I can apply (I've heard that clear top coat nail polish works) to keep it from unraveling, or anything I can do at all?
